March 2011 Bandsters

Hi Everyone!!

Where are all the March bandsters at?!! I was just approved last week and have a surgery date of March 16th. Looks like I'll be starting a two week pre-op liquid diet (Optifast) on March 2nd which I'm not looking forward to!! Anyone else scheduled for March? Do you have a pre-op diet to follow?

Good Luck to everyone!! :)

My surgery date is March 21, 2011. It sure has been a long time coming. I started this journey with the medically supervised diet classes in Nov 2009. Due to insurance requirements, I had to endure 12 months of the diet classes. Even when I seen the surgeon on Feb. 1, he told me not to get into a hurry due to my insurance company's history of denials. But to everyone's surprise, the paperwork was submitted on Feb. 10 and approval came on Feb. 18. I have missed feelings of anxiety, excited, and scared just to name a few. Anxious to have pre-op appointment on March 8 to find out what the diet will be. YAY ME!!:)

I am getting banded on 3/18/11. It was supposed to be 3/1/11 and I had already done my 2 week optifast diet. Well, went to doctor this morning and the insurance screwed up the hospital so now I have to start over. Yep, 2 more weeks of optifast starting on 3/4/11. I wanted to cry at the dr today but I will suck it up and just count it as extra time to prepare. Lost 10 lbs on optifast and it is not as bad as you think. The chocolate is better than the vanilla but they were both pretty good.
